python和django是广泛应用于web开发的流行工具,特别是在构建动态和复杂的web应用程序时。本篇文章将讨论使用python和django构建web应用程序所需的最佳实践。1.明确需求和目标在开始开发应用程序之前,您需要明确应用程序...
python是一种强大的编程语言,而django是一个流行的python web框架。使用django,你可以很轻松地创建高度模块化和可扩展的web应用程序。本文将介绍如何在python中使用django创建web应用程序。安装Django...
在日常的数据处理场景中,不同格式的数据处理需要不同的解析方式。对于xml格式的数据,我们可以使用python中的正则表达式进行解析。本文将介绍使用python正则表达式进行xml处理的基本思路和方法。XML基础介绍XML(Extensibl...
scrapy是一个强大的python爬虫框架,它可以大大简化爬虫的开发和部署过程。在实际应用中,我们经常需要使用scrapy批量下载或上传文件,如图片、音频或视频等资源。本文将介绍如何使用scrapy实现这些功能。批量下载文件Scrapy提...
在日常编码中,我们经常需要对代码进行修改和重构,以增加代码的可读性和可维护性。其中一个重要的工具就是正则表达式。本篇文章将介绍如何使用python正则表达式进行代码重构的一些常用技巧。一、查找和替换正则表达式最常用的功能之一是查找和替换。假...
随着互联网的快速发展,大量的文本数据被生成和存储,处理这些文本数据已经变成了日常工作中的必备技能。而关键词匹配是文本挖掘过程中最基础、最常见且最重要的任务之一。本文将介绍如何使用python正则表达式进行关键词匹配。一、正则表达式简介正则表...
什么是逆波兰表达式?逆波兰表达式也被称为后缀表达式,是一种不需要括号来区分操作符优先级的算术表达式表示方法。其特点是操作符在操作数的后面。例如,将中缀表达式“3 + 4 5”转换为逆波兰表达式后为“3 4 5 +”。Python正则表达...
随着软件开发的不断发展,测试覆盖率已经成为一个非常重要的指标。测试覆盖率是指在进行软件测试时,所有的代码是否都被覆盖到,即每行代码是否至少执行了一次。而python是一门非常流行的编程语言,其内置了强大的正则表达式模块re,可以用来进行文本...
在数据处理的过程中,有时候我们需要对大量的数据进行筛选、清洗等操作,这时使用python的正则表达式可大大提高数据处理的效率。下面将介绍如何使用python正则表达式进行大数据处理。准备数据首先需要准备一份需要处理的数据,例如一份包含50万...
scrapy是一个基于python的爬虫框架,可以快速而方便地获取互联网上的相关信息。在本篇文章中,我们将通过一个scrapy案例来详细解析如何抓取linkedin上的公司信息。确定目标URL首先,我们需要明确我们的目标是LinkedIn上...